Most of us think heart health is all about diet, exercise, and genetics. But what if your relationships, stress levels, and emotional connections are playing a much bigger role than you realize?  In this powerful episode of Healthy YOU, Frankye Myers sits down with Dr. Britany Thompson, vascular surgeon with Riverside Vascular Specialists, to explore the hidden connection between emotional well-being and cardiovascular health. From chronic stress and loneliness to supportive relationships and strong social bonds, they unpack how the body responds physically to what we often label as “just stress.”

Men and Mental Health: How to Start the Conversation

From depression and anxiety to burnout, stress, and emotional isolation, many men struggle in silence or show signs in ways that often go unrecognized. In this episode, our host Frankye Myers sits down with Dr. Ryan McQueen, board-certified psychiatrist with Riverside Mental Health & Recovery Center, for an honest conversation about men’s mental health. Together, they break down the stigma surrounding mental health, discuss the warning signs loved ones should look for, and share practical ways to start meaningful conversations with the men in our lives.  Whether you’re checking in on yourself, a friend, a partner, or a family member, this episode offers insight, encouragement, and real tools to help start the conversation.
